About 2,000,000 people visited the aquarium last year. If this number were rounded to the nearest million, what was the greatest
notsponge [240]
Okay, so there's a number rounded to the nearest million, in this case 2 million. So this tells me that the number of visitors is between 1,500,000 and 2,499,999. The reason why 1,499,999 doesn't count is because the hundred thousands digit is not 5 or above, so it doesn't count. It would round down to 1 million, not 2 million. The reason why 2,500,000 doesn't count, is because the hundred thousands digit is 5, so that rounds to 3 million, not 2 million. The greatest number of visitors that visited the aquarium has to be 2,499,999, because that's one digit away from 2.5 million, and the hundred thousands digit is a 4, not 5. The answer is 2,499,999
